Abstract | The effect of carbon addition on microstructural evolution was studied in a near-a titanium alloy (Ti-5.6Al4.8Sn-2Zr-1Mo-0.35Si-0.7Nd). It was found that flake and ribbon titanium carbides with a NaCl crystal structure formed in the as-cast alloys with carbon additions of over 0.17 wt pct. Flake carbide particles are the product of eutectic transformation and precipitate from the high-temperature beta phase. The ribbon carbide particles are primary phases formed prior to the nucleation of any metallic phases. The as-cast alloys with carbide precipitation after heat-treatment at beta(t)-30 degrees C followed by water quenching showed the spheroidization of a lamellae and partial dissolution of carbide particles. After annealing at beta(t)+15 degrees C, carbide particles are mostly distributed at the grain boundary and spheroidized through mixed grain boundary plus bulk diffusions. |
